The volume of a gas held at a constant temperature varies inversely with the pressure of the gas. If the volume of a gas is 5000

cubic centimeters when the pressure is 200 millimeters of mercury, what is the volume when the pressure is 500 millimeters of mercury?

Answer:

2,000 cubic centimeters

Step-by-step explanation:

if two variables vary inversely, there is a negative relationship between both variables. the increase in one variable leads to a decrease in the other variable

the equation that represents inverse proportion :

v = \frac{b}{p}

where b = constant of proportionality

5000 = b / 200

b = 5000 x 200 = 1,000,000

v = 1,000,000 / 500

v = 2000
